Suicide Squad Reshoots Underway; Jai Courtney Responds

Following the less than well received Batman Vs. Superman, it was rumored WB was going back to do reshoots for Suicide Squad to inject a bit more humor, which is similar to what is seen in the trailers.

Now reshoots are confirmed as Entertainment Tonight caught up with Jai Courtney who explains it’s to add in more action and comments on the rumors.

ā€œI wouldn’t say we’re going back to make it funnier,ā€ Courtney said in the below video Ā ā€œThere’s some additional action stuff we’ve been doing which is pretty dope… Can’t believe everything you read.ā€

However, a ā€œtech guyā€ working on Hollywood is actually on the scene of the Suicide Squad reshoots where he claims he spoke with someone on set who says the reason is ā€œit was too dark.ā€

ā€œSuicide Squadā€ has an August 5, 2016 release date directed by David Ayer starring Will Smith as Deadshot, Jared Leto as the Joker, Margot Robbie as Harley Quinn, Cara Delevingne as Enchantress, Jai Courtney as Boomerang, Joel Kinnaman as Rick Flag, Viola Davis as Amanda Waller, Adam Beach as Slipknot, Karen Fukuhara as Katana, Adewale Akinnuoye-Agbaje as Killer Croc, Jay Hernandez as El Diablo, and Scott Eastwood in an unknown role.
